Typical Dredge Process <br />^ USACOE hydraulically dredges cherineharid <br />pumps 15%-20% slurry to the DMMS <br />^ High water content slurry decants in the <br />DMMS for a year or more until the material <br />dries sufficiently to be transported <br />^ At City's expense the dried material is <br />removed, and trucked to a disposal area. In <br />'- 2004, the material was disposed at the Oyster <br />Bay Regional Park <br />^ Cost for disposal depending on disposal <br />location range from $24 to $53lcubic yard <br />Oyster Bay Park Disposal <br />Alternative <br />^ USACOE willing to pump slurry to other <br />similar location where it becomes property of <br />City <br />^ Piping is possible to the near water area of <br />~~ Oyster Bay Park <br />^ City would be responsible to transport slurry <br />~ to disposal area and decant material to <br />remove water to consolidate material <br />Disposal to Oyster Bay Park <br />5 <br />
